Magic of 'wayang kulit' comes to life at Bank Negara museum exhibit


By AGENCY
Shafiee Hassan's painting 'Seniman Dan Warisan Wayang Kulit (1987) is one of the artworks at the 'Gerak Bayang: Seni Penceritaan' exhibition at Bank Negara Malaysia Museum and Art Gallery in Kuala Lumpur. Photo: Bank Negara Malaysia Museum and Art Gallery

A total of 144 artworks, including wayang kulit (shadow puppets) instruments, paintings, sculptures, and new media are now on display at the Bank Negara Malaysia Museum and Art Gallery’s (BNM MAG).

BNM MAG curator Siti Melorinda Khuzaini Sakdudin said the artworks, by 39 well-known and new artists, including familiar names such as Long Thien Shih, Nik Zainal Abidin, Ismail Mat Hussin, Nik Husyaidie, Haris Abadi and Adeputra, will be on display until Jan 28 next year.
